Brit Hop
Fuller's Brewery in Chiswick, Greater London, England 🏴
Bitter - Ordinary / Best Bitter Regular Out of Production|
Score
6.37
|
|
Hops used: Admiral, Challenger, First Gold, Fuggles, Goldings, Northdown, Sovereign, Target.
